What is NapoliGdańsk?
NapoliGdańsk is a single-brand food ordering app for iOS and Android, allowing local customers to browse menus and place delivery or pickup orders.
The app serves the restaurant's need to capture direct-to-consumer sales without paying aggregator commission fees, while providing customers a dedicated channel for their favorite local menu.

The outtake for NapoliGdańsk
Strengths to defend, gaps to attack
Core Strengths
- Commission-free transaction path preserves restaurant margins
- Direct-to-consumer relationship avoids platform-level interference
Critical Frictions
- No loyalty program or gamified retention loops
- Lacks real-time delivery tracking and predictive algorithms
Growth Levers
- Implement one-tap reordering to reduce friction
- Introduce digital loyalty rewards to drive repeat visits
Market Threats
- Aggregator logistics infrastructure creates high switching costs
- Aggregator discovery tools siphon local traffic

A counter-intuitive read
The app's lack of scale is its primary defense: by remaining a single-brand utility, it avoids the commoditization and high commission pressure that plague restaurants on aggregator platforms.

Where Is It Heading?
Stable
The local food ordering market is consolidating around platforms that offer integrated logistics and rewards. NapoliGdańsk remains stable as a direct-to-consumer tool, but it must introduce retention mechanics to survive the shift toward aggregator-led discovery.
The app maintains a steady, utility-focused update cadence, prioritizing core ordering functionality over aggressive feature expansion.
Aggregator-driven convenience continues to pull casual users away, increasing the churn pressure on single-brand apps that lack loyalty incentives.
